The Cosmic QCD Phase Transition, Quasi-baryonic Dark Matter and Massive Compact Halo Objects

We propose that the cold dark matter (CDM) is composed entirely of quark matter, arising from a cosmic quark-hadron transition. We denote this phase as "quasibaryonic", distinct from the usual baryons. We show that compact gravitational lenses, with masses around 0.5 (M_{\odot}), could have evolved out of the quasibaryonic CDM.
